CAN YOU SHARE WITH US A LITTLE BIT ABOUT YOUR JOURNEY AND HOW YOU GOT TO WHERE YOU ARE TODAY?

I have many chronic illnesses and health issues which always made me and others think cheerleading was not possible for me. I have Elhers Danlos Syndrome which is the “glue” that holds your body together is too stretchy and causes dislocations, pain, other health issues and many more things. I also have a paralyzed stomach (gastroparesis), orthostatic intolerance which means my blood pressure doesn’t stabilize well and means I can often go lightheaded and also am deaf in my right ear. Everyone always told me that cheerleading isn’t something that’s possible and that it’s too dangerous and I won’t be able to physically do it.


I didn’t care and did it anyway.


By doing that, I’ve learnt that anything really is possible if you just try and put everything into it, whilst making adaptations that work for you. Having a supportive team has helped me a lot and given me a new family. It’s helped to remind me that you can never give up on your goals regardless of what obstacles are put in your way.

Fitness is important regardless of health because it helps keep everything moving and I really notice when I haven’t had cheer or any form of exercise. I notice my health deteriorates and my mood goes down too.

CAN YOU SHARE WITH US A LITTLE BIT ABOUT YOUR JOURNEY AND HOW YOU GOT TO WHERE YOU ARE TODAY?

At the end of last season, I was losing weight rapidly, and getting weak. I lost most of my level 2 skills, and we didn’t understand why. I decided not to try out for my Allstar team, because I was always so tired, and I didn’t have the energy to practice or compete.

In June, my parents took me to the doctor to figure out what was wrong with me. After an exam and blood tests I was rushed to Children’s Hospital in Dallas where I was diagnosed with Type 1 Diabetes. Upon arrival, my blood sugar was over 800 (normal is 100). I spent a week in the hospital cleaning the sugar out of my blood and learning how to live with Type 1 Diabetes. There is no cure. I have to give myself a shot of insulin every time I eat during the day, and before I go to bed at night.

But, soon after diagnosis, I felt so much better. I wasn’t weak and tired. I had energy, and I really missed my Allstar team. My coach let me have a private tryout because he knew how bad I wanted back on the team. Even though I did not have all my level 2 skills back, I promised him I would work hard to get all my skills back before competition season started.


I worked hard to build the muscles in my body back.


Within 3 months I had gained 8 lbs, and all that was muscle. I kept my promise to my coach and my team; before competition season started, I had all of my level 2 skills back, and better than ever before. . .but I didn’t stop working there. Five months later, I have my level 3 skills as well. I was so happy the first day I landed my tuck. Diabetes tried to take that away from me, but I worked to hard to let the disease win. Fitness and diet along with my medications are the only way to stay ahead of my Type 1 Diabetes.

CAN YOU SHARE WITH US A LITTLE BIT ABOUT YOUR JOURNEY AND HOW YOU GOT TO WHERE YOU ARE TODAY?

Hi! My name is Aivree and this is my story. In July of 2012 I started feeling bad and went to the doctor, After several visits and a trip to Texas Children’s I was diagnosed with Henoch Schonelin Purpura. It’s not genetic or contagious. It causes/can cause multiple issues like fevers, being sick to your stomach, severe joint swelling and pain, hypertension, renal failure and it cause your capillaries to burst and bleed out under your skin.

I was in a wheel chair on days I couldn’t walk. I had to wear house shoes for months due to swelling in my feet. I missed school due to fevers and missed Halloween while being tested for intussusception of the intestines. I had these issues off and on for 18 months.

Starting Cheer helped me strengthen my body again. But it really strengthened my mind. I started thinking more positively. I had goals in cheer I wanted to achieve that I had to work hard for.


Cheer gave me a purpose and a desire to push myself to get stronger and better.


My team and coaches gave me the encouragement to become better than I ever thought I could. Then this past year I found CHEERFIT and it has just enhanced it all. With monthly meetings and workouts that target certain areas, I have continued to grow and achieve more goals. I fell in love with this sport that gave me my life back and with CHEERFIT on my side nothing is impossible!
